Fix LTTng build for build environments with older liblttng-ust-dev (dotnet/coreclr...
authorSung Yoon Whang <suwhang@microsoft.com>
Fri, 18 Oct 2019 05:31:07 +0000 (22:31 -0700)
committerGitHub <noreply@github.com>
Fri, 18 Oct 2019 05:31:07 +0000 (22:31 -0700)
commit41d3cca50ba285ba3622ce68c338407aa7d411e5
tree911564fafa1191280a52384b6059485ff0ce822c
parentceb3f37b2e7d05fae071eea6ae28e823272f2d1e
Fix LTTng build for build environments with older liblttng-ust-dev  (dotnet/coreclr#27273)

* Fix macro redefinition to use XplatEventLogger instead of simply writing FALSE

* Fix linker error

* undo newline changes

* Some changes to comment

* Move wrapper export from eventpipe.cpp to eventtrace.cpp

Commit migrated from https://github.com/dotnet/coreclr/commit/1e7552afb359d1fba2dc57d6f82f03d20db32dd2
src/coreclr/src/scripts/genLttngProvider.py
src/coreclr/src/vm/eventtrace.cpp